NinjaOne offers free tools to MSPs amid market pressures

Yesterday

NinjaOne has announced that it will offer its Warranty Tracking feature free of charge to all its managed service provider (MSP) customers. Additionally, the company's Documentation product will be made available for up to three users at no cost to any MSP customer. To facilitate the transition for new customers, NinjaOne has also introduced white-glove Professional Services aimed at aiding large MSPs in migrating their technology stacks without business disruption.

Vic Guerrero, Director of Channel and Alliances, APAC, elaborated on the significance of these offerings for Australian customers. "Australian MSPs are under constant pressure to keep up with the evolving digital landscape, whether it be finding ways to leverage artificial intelligence, or protecting against emerging cyber threats," Guerrero stated. "The ability to track existing warranty timelines with ease, ensuring replacements never disrupt processes and can be implemented with ease, is integral to remaining on pace with the fast-moving environment they work in."

The new Warranty Tracking feature, currently in beta, automates the management and tracking of device warranty information. This ensures that businesses are never disrupted because replacements are ready or new warranties are in place before existing ones expire. Early access customers have highlighted various advantages, with 3% citing the consolidation of disparate tools and cost savings as the primary benefit. This was followed by 17% who cited the effective management of device lifecycles and 10% who noted revenue generation through warranty tracking.

Similarly, NinjaOne Documentation is a centralised platform consolidating IT knowledge on processes, devices, users, and security. This centralisation aids MSPs in onboarding new technicians faster, saving time that would typically be wasted searching for information and enhancing overall knowledge sharing.

Research from analyst firm Omdia found that seven in every ten customers replaced more than four tools with NinjaOne, while 91% replaced more than two tools. Another study from Enterprise Strategy Group indicated that NinjaOne typically replaces at least four tools in most ecosystems and lowers Full Time Employee (FTE) costs by 41%.

NinjaOne's remote monitoring and management (RMM) platform has consistently been recognised as being the top-rated RMM on review site G2 every quarter since 2019. The company has introduced over 250 new features and enhancements this year, guided largely by MSP feedback on its public roadmap. NinjaOne's Script Hub offers hundreds of powerful, easy-to-use scripts, contributing to 95% of customers saving time through automation, as noted by Omdia.
